Overview

Situated in Caraș-Severin, Romania, Dezești is a small village. On the world map it falls within the Eastern Hemisphere, specifically at 45.469°, 21.891°. Recent open-data figures place its population at about 223. Its latitude implies a climate characterised by four distinct seasons with warm summers and cold winters. Solar-resource estimates put the area at about 1,347 kWh/m² of solar irradiance per year with sunshine for roughly 53% of daylight hours.
